This oil on canvas painting by William Mellor depicts a traditional British river landscape. The composition features cattle wading and watering in a calm river, which reflects the soft light of a clouded sky. The scene is flanked by densely wooded banks and hazy hills in the far distance. The artist uses fine brushwork for the atmospheric sky and more expressive, textured strokes for the foliage. A signature in reddish-brown pigment is located in the lower right corner. The reverse of the canvas features a manufacturer’s stamp for G. Rowney & Co, London, W., Quality B. The work is housed in a contemporary light-toned wooden box frame. A small white auction label from Shobrook & Co, Plymouth, is attached to the frame.


Condition report:

The painting exhibits a significant accumulation of surface dirt and dust across the entire paint layer. The original varnish has yellowed considerably over time, affecting the overall colour balance, particularly in the sky and water. Fine, stable craquelure is visible throughout the paint surface. The canvas support remains stable on its original wooden stretcher, with minor staining and darkening to the reverse. The modern replacement frame is in good condition.
